Land in Gisborne Land District for Lease by Public Auction.
District Lands and Survey Office,
Gisborne, 18th December, 1940.
NOTICE is hereby given that the undermentioned section
will be offered for lease by public auction at the
District Lands and Survey Office, Gisborne, on Monday,
27th January, 1941, at 2.30 o'clock p.m., under the provisions
of the Land Act, 1924.
SCHEDULE.
GISBORNE LAND DISTRICT.—FIRST-CLASS LAND.
Cook County.—Hangaroa Survey District.
SECTION 1A, Block XV : Area, 10 acres. Upset annual
rental, £2.
Weighted with £67 (payable in cash) for improvements,
comprising felling and grassing, road fencing, and half-share
boundary fencing.
This section is situated near Tiniroto Village, about 2½
chains off the present Gisborne-Napier Highway. Access is
by way of the old highway which is formed but not metalled.
Land comprises easy hill country mostly ploughable and is
in good pasture. It is ring-fenced and is well watered.
Any further particulars required may be obtained from
the undersigned.

Village Land in Gisborne Land District for Selection on
Renewable Lease.
District Lands and Survey Office,
Gisborne, 18th December, 1940.
NOTICE is hereby given that the undermentioned section
is open for selection on renewable lease under the
Land Act, 1924; and applications will be received at the
District Lands and Survey Office, Gisborne, up to 4 o'clock
p.m. on Wednesday, 12th February, 1941.
Applicants should appear personally for examination at
the District Lands and Survey Office, Gisborne, on Friday,
14th February, 1941, at 10.30 o'clock a.m., but if any applicant
is unable to attend he may be examined by any other Land
Board or by any Commissioner of Crown Lands.
The ballot will be held immediately upon conclusion of the
examination of applicants, and the successful applicant is
required to pay immediately at conclusion of ballot a deposit
comprising the first half-year's rent, broken-period rent,
lease fee, and amount of weighting for improvements.
SCHEDULE.
GISBORNE LAND DISTRICT.—VILLAGE LAND.
Waikohu County.—Motu Village.
SECTION 1, Block V: Area, 1 acre. Capital value, £20;
half-yearly rent, 10s.
Weighted with £3 (payable in cash) for improvements,
comprising road-boundary fencing and felling and grassing.
This section which is situated in King Street, adjoining the
store-site, comprises flat land in rushes and rough pasture.
The section is somewhat damp but when developed should
be very suitable for the running of a house cow. It is ring-
fenced, but fences on eastern and southern boundaries are in
poor order; a new fence has recently been erected on western
boundary.
Special condition.—The successful applicant is required,
before the lease is issued, to arrange with the adjoining
owners for half-value of the boundary fencing.
Any further information required may be obtained from
the undersigned.

Land in Nelson Land District for Selection on Renewable Lease.
District Lands and Survey Office,
Nelson, 18th December, 1940.
NOTICE is hereby given that the undermentioned section
is open for selection on renewable lease under the
Land Act, 1924; and applications will be received at the
District Lands and Survey Office, Nelson, up to 11 o'clock
a.m. on Tuesday, 14th January, 1941.
G
Applicants should appear personally for examination at
the District Lands and Survey Office, Nelson, on Thursday,
16th January, 1941, at 10 o'clock a.m., but if any applicant is
unable to attend he may be examined by any other Land
Board or by any Commissioner of Crown Lands. Applicants
are required to produce documentary evidence of their
farming experience and financial position.
The ballot will be held immediately upon conclusion of the
examination of applicants, and the successful applicant is
required to pay immediately at conclusion of ballot a deposit
comprising the first half-year's rent, broken-period rent, lease
fee, deposit in reduction of weighting for improvements,
and proportionate part of insurance on the buildings.
NOTE.—This section is offered in terms of section 153 of
the Land Act, 1924. which provides that no right to any
mineral under the surface shall pertain to the lessee, whose
rights shall be to the surface soil only.
SCHEDULE.
NELSON LAND DISTRICT.—FIRST-CLASS LAND.
Murchison County.—Lyell Survey District.—Westland Mining
District.
SECTION 53, Square 138, Block XV: Area, 24 acres 0 roods
28 perches. Capital value, £40; half-yearly rent, 16s.
Weighted with £113 for improvements, comprising dwelling
and cow-byrne (both in poor condition), hay-shed, pig-sty,
35 chains road fencing, 35 chains subdivisional fencing,
12 acres clearing and stumping, and 20 acres grassing. This
sum is payable in cash, or, after payment of a deposit of £13,
the balance may be repaid over a period of five years by
half-yearly instalments of principal and interest (5 per cent.)
combined, amounting to £11 11s. per half-year.
Situated on the main Buller Gorge road four miles from
Newton Flat Post-office, three miles from Newton Flat School,
twenty-eight miles and thirty-six miles from Inangahua
and Glenhope Railway-stations respectively, and eight
miles from Murchison Dairy Factory and Saleyards. The
area is flat, about half being in clear paddocks, the remainder
having some fern and blackberry with little timber. Soil
is fair loam resting on gravel formation. Pastures are worn
and top-dressing is required. The section is watered by the
Buller River and is suitable for dairying in a small way by
someone with outside employment.
Any further particulars required may be obtained from
the undersigned.
